iOS 14固件签名是指将iOS 14固件文件与设备的唯一标识符(UDID)进行加密匹配,以确保只有特定设备才能安装该固件。这是苹果公司为了保护其iOS生态系统而采取的一种措施,以防止用户在未经授权的情况下安装非官方的iOS固件。
iOS 14固件签名的原理是基于公钥加密技术,该技术使用了一对密钥:公钥和私钥。公钥是公开的,可以用于加密数据,而私钥则是私有的,用于解密数据。在iOS 14固件签名过程中,苹果公司使用私钥将UDID和固件文件进行加密匹配,然后生成一个签名文件。设备在安装iOS 14固件时,会将该签名文件与固件文件进行比对,如果匹配成功,则可以安装该固件文件。
iOS 14固件签名的详细流程如下:
1. 开发者或苹果公司发布iOS 14固件文件,并将其上传到苹果服务器。
2. 用户在iTunes或OTA(Over-the-Air)升级时,设备会向苹果服务器请求固件文件和签名文件。
3. 苹果服务器会将固件文件和签名文件一起发送给设备。
4. 设备会将固件文件和签名文件进行比对,如果匹配成功,则可以安装该固件文件。
5. 如果签名文件与固件文件不匹配,则设备会提示“固件文件不兼容”错误,并停止安装该固件文件。
需要注意的是,iOS 14固件签名只能在苹果公司的服务器上进行,因此用户无法自行签名iOS 14固件文件,也无法安装未经授权的iOS 14固件文件。这是苹果公司为了保护其iOS生态系统而采取的一种措施,以确保用户的设备安全可靠。
总之,iOS 14固件签名是苹果公司为了保护其iOS生态系统而采取的一种措施,以确保用户只能安装官方的iOS 14固件文件。该技术基于公钥加密技术,使用了一对密钥:公钥和私钥。在iOS 14固件签名过程中,苹果公司使用私钥将UDID和固件文件进行加密匹配,然后生成一个签名文件。设备在安装iOS 14固件时,会将该签名文件与固件文件进行比对,如果匹配成功,则可以安装该固件文件。